    You can get a real classic hot dog at Wolfys. But, did you know that they also serve soups, salads and other sandwiches like Italian beef/combo, gyros, pepper and egg and chicken? They also offer a few dinner plates such as shrimp, and value meals. A Chicago classic since 1967, take a step back in time and enjoy the old time decor along with their delicious food. Get your custom hot dog, a drink, split a humungous order of French Fries and enjoy the atmosphere!

    Maybe it was a bad day at Wolfy's, or maybe being the first ones in the door at opening time isn't a good idea. But the three of us agreed that Wolfy's didn't live up to the hype. Over the years, we've been trying to slowly work our way through as many different Chicago hot dog and/or Italian beef spots as we reasonably can (by "reasonably," I mean one per Chicago visit), and Wolfy's is highly ranked on multiple lists on reputable food sites. And the sign out front--with a big hot dog speared on a grilling fork--is a classic of its kind. The inside, too, has plenty of old-school hot-dog-joint charm, with lots of red-and-white tile and brick. I had the Italian beef (maybe a mistake at a place apparently not renowned for them). The wife had a Maxwell Street Polish, and the brother-in-law had a regular Chicago dog. For each of us, the verdict was that we'd had better elsewhere in town. The Italian beef was massive--no complaints there--but rather dried out and lacking in flavor. (Unfortunately, I can speak to the specific shortcomings of the wife's and brother-in-law's items, although I can say that buns on those dogs were falling apart before they were halfway through them.) Fries were piping hot and solid, though! Service was kinda perfunctory. Maybe that's what you should expect in a Chicago hot dog joint--this isn't fine dining, after all--but we've certainly had some other Chicago hot dog proprietors go out of their way to be super-friendly and welcoming in the past.
